His oldest pups are 2....every pup I no of has no problem treeing coon and owners are happy with them.....TREE DOGS!!! They have nice mouths and are real nice track dogs....I no of 1 that is a guys first hound and was hunting him steady all winter in Minnesota before he was a year old and treed coon like a 5 yro.....there independent but not to a fault.....I’ve hunted with Botox a couple times and his mom MANY times.....that cross was made to produce coondogs!
